This adds the GetInitState and InitState messages along with appropriate tests. It also adds a new protocol version (version 8) and bumps the current wire version to it. This set of messages will be used to allow peers to exchange ephemeral startup information in a more general manner than the current existing GetMiningState/MiningState pair. In particular, peers will be able to selectively request only the specific startup info they're insterested in so that different types of nodes (such as SPV clients) may only request relevant startup information. Compared to the existing MiningState message, the InitState message already offers a new type of data: tspend hashes, that nodes may use to fetch tspend transactions for inspecting, generating templates and voting on their approval.
